A reversible adsorption-desorption parking process in one dimension is studied. An exact solution for the equilibrium properties is obtained. The coverage near saturation depends logarithmically on the ratio between the adsorption rate, k + , and the desorption rate, k − , ρ eq ∼ = 1 − 1/ log(k + /k −), when k + /k − ≫ 1. Pesticide sorption in soils is controlled by time-dependent processes such as diffusion into soil aggregates and microscopic sorbent particles. This study examines the rate-controlling step for time-dependent sorption in clay loam aggregates. Influence of mesoporosity on the sorption of 2,4-dichlorophenoxyacetic acid onto alumina and silica.
Two SiO2 and three Al2O3 adsorbents with varying degrees of mesoporosity (pore diameter 2-50 nm) were reacted with 2,4-dichlorophenoxyacetic acid (2,4-D) at pH 6 to investigate the effects of intraparticle mesopores on adsorption/desorption. The dissociative adsorption of H2 on the Si(001) surface is theoretically investigated for several reaction pathways using quantum Monte Carlo methods. Our reaction energies and barriers are at large variance with those obtained with commonly used approximate exchange-correlation density functionals. The interaction of acetone with single wall carbon nanotubes (SWCNTs) was studied by temperature programmed desorption with mass spectrometry (TPD-MS), after reflux, sonication, or exposure to 7.6 Torr of acetone vapors at room temperature. The fate of Pb in the environment is highly dependent on sorption and desorption reactions on solid surfaces. In this study Pb sorption and desorption kinetics on γ-Al2O3 at pH 6.50, I ) 0.1 M, and [Pb]initial ) 2 mM were investigated using both macroscopic and spectroscopic measurements.
